Interest rates for hard money loans in Minnehaha typically range from 7.5% to 15%, but they can vary widely depending on several factors. These factors include the type of property being financed, the borrower's credit history, the size and duration of the loan, and the specific lender’s terms. Hard money loans are often used for short-term, asset-based financing, which is why the rates tend to be higher than traditional bank loans. Additionally, borrowers should be aware that fees, points, and other costs may be added to the overall loan, making the total cost of borrowing higher. Always compare terms from multiple lenders to ensure the best deal for your specific needs.
